Old Greenwich resident Gervais Hearn is the incoming president of the board of directors for the Association of Fundraising Professionals Fairfield County for 2015.
AFP Fairfield County, a member of AFP International, is a professional association seeking to generate philanthropic support for 2,800 nonprofit and charitable organizations in the county.
AFP by its mission fosters the education, development and growth of fundraising professionals. It has 213 chapters and 30,000 members globally.
Gervais is the development director of the September 11th Memorial in Greenwich. The organization seeks to honor the memory of the 32 people with ties to Greenwich who lost their lives on 9/11.
Previously, Hearn served as director of parish development at Christ Church in Greenwich.
“I look forward to 2015, working with a strong board and providing new initiatives that will grow our membership,” Hearn said. “We will offer excellent education programs and fun opportunities for networking.”
The AFP Fairfield County provides regular professional development opportunities and networking for those involved in fundraising, either vocationally or as volunteers. Monthly meetings with featured speakers are held the first Thursday of every month from September to June at The Norwalk Inn & Conference Center in Norwalk.
